Voils (excluding leno fabrics)

Cotton voil woven fabrics, plain weave, lightweight

DGFT CLEARANCE

HSN 5208 51 80 (Voils, excluding leno fabrics) is subject to the ITC (HS) import policy administered by the Directorate General of Foreign Trade (DGFT), which requires a Pre-Shipment Inspection Certificate confirming the absence of prohibited hazardous azo dyes under General Note 10 of the ITC (HS) Import Policy. The azo-dye testing requirement applies to all exporting countries except EU, Serbia, Poland, Denmark, Australia, Canada, Japan, South Korea, and the United Kingdom.

Compliance steps
  1. 1
    Obtain a Pre-Shipment Inspection Certificate (PSIC) from an accredited laboratory in the exporting country, or a valid test report from a Textile Committee (TC) or Central Sheep and Wool Research Institute (CSRTI) laboratory, certifying the absence of prohibited hazardous azo dyes before the consignment is shipped to India.
    General Note 10 of the ITC (HS) Import Policy · DGFT Public Notice 14/2023 dated 14-06-2023
  2. 2
    If the origin is EU, Serbia, Poland, Denmark, Australia, Canada, Japan, South Korea, or the United Kingdom, the azo-dye testing requirement is waived; however, document the origin-based exemption at the bill of entry. For all other origins, the PSIC is mandatory and failure to produce it at the port will result in consignment detention.
    General Note 10 of the ITC (HS) Import Policy · DGFT Public Notice 14/2023 dated 14-06-2023
A word of counsel

The most common error on this tariff line is assuming the azo-dye PSIC exemption extends to any country not explicitly blacklisted, when in fact the exemption is a closed positive list — only the nine named jurisdictions qualify. A consignment from any origin outside that list arriving without a PSIC or TC/CSRTI test report will be detained at the port of import pending production of the certificate, accumulating demurrage and ground rent with no rectification shortcut available post-arrival.

Frequently asked
Does HSN 5208 51 80 require BIS certification?
No, woven cotton voil fabrics are not covered by any BIS Quality Control Order. Import compliance is governed by the Directorate General of Foreign Trade under the ITC (HS) Import Policy, with a Pre-Shipment Inspection Certificate requirement for azo-dye absence under General Note 10.
Which laboratory can issue the PSIC for azo-dye testing?
The PSIC must be issued by an accredited laboratory in the exporting country, or alternatively a valid test report from a Textile Committee or CSRTI laboratory is accepted, per DGFT Public Notice 14/2023 dated 14-06-2023.
Does the azo-dye exemption for named countries waive all textile documentation requirements?
No. The exemption applies only to azo-dye testing; other applicable DGFT import-policy conditions and customs documentation obligations at the bill of entry remain unaffected for exempted-origin consignments.
